if (!prompt) {
console.error("Error: Prompt required");
console.error("Usage: bun run generate.ts \"prompt\" [options]");
console.error("Options:");
console.error(" --input <path> Starting frame image (image-to-video)");
console.error(" --ref <path> Reference image for subject consistency (up to 3, Replicate Veo only)");
console.error(" --last-frame <path> Ending frame for interpolation (Replicate Veo only)");
console.error(" --style <id> Art style from styles.json");
console.error(" --aspect <ratio> 16:9 (default) or 9:16");
console.error(" --resolution <res> 720p (default), 1080p, 4k");
console.error(" --duration <sec> 4, 6, 8 (default: 8)");
console.error(" --negative <text> Negative prompt");
console.error(" --seed <n> Random seed");
console.error(" --output <path> Output .mp4 path");
console.error(" --model <name> veo (default), replicate-veo (Replicate Veo 3.1), or grok");
console.error(" --no-audio Disable audio generation (Replicate Veo only)");
console.error(" --auto-image With --style, auto-generate styled image first");
process.exit(1);
}
